Ponza Island Day Trip
Enjoy a day trip from Rome to Ponza Island. Cruise along the waters, feel the breeze in your hair and cool off with a dip in the Tyrrhenian Sea!
Description
We'll meet in the Piazza di Porta San Paolo in Rome at 6:45 am, and from there, we'll board a minibus to take us to the port of Anzio. After paying for the boat tickets, we'll take the ferry to Ponza Island.
After an hour and a half sailing, we'll reach the port of Ponza, where you'll have approximately an hour and a half to have breakfast and replenish your energy before enjoying our boat ride.
After breakfast, we'll meet the other people joining us on the tour from other locations, and then we'll board our boat, ready to spend 5 hours cruising along the Tyrrhenian Sea.
The captain will sail to the best spots on the island, passing old ruins and caves, and we'll anchor down up to five times so that you can jump into the waters and explore. This is the perfect moment to go snorkelling, as there is so much marine fauna to be discovered!
The captain will make the most of one of the stops to prepare some pasta so that we can enjoy a simple but delicious lunch onboard. You'll need it after all that swimming!
Afterwards, we'll return to the port of Ponza, where you'll have approximately 1 hour of free time to wander around its beautiful streets. At 5:30 pm, we'll take the ferry back to Anzio and start our journey back to Rome. We'll end the tour at the initial meeting point, arriving between 7:45 pm and 8:45 pm.
